On the eve of Tucker Carlson's interview with Russian President Vladimir Putin going live, we uploaded a video clip showing Tucker's introduction of that interview with commentary from Alex Jones and his team. YouTube not only removed the clip, but deleted it so that we couldn't even download it again and upload it to an alternative platform like Rumble. In this podcast episode we wonder what was the issue with the video? Also touch a bit on the interview between Carlson and Putin as well as some commentary on the Trump trials, specifically the testimony of Fulton County, GA District Attorney Fani Willis.
